Virbon Frial slipped past the Ayuyus for MHS 2’s winning goal 24 minutes into the first half. Frial, assisted by sophomore Frank Gu, returned with three more attempts alongside Darren Gabrido.
Both squads resulted in a stalemate in the second half.
In a following game, “Mount Carmel School scored the first two goals before MHS [1] answered with senior forward Mike Camacho’s goal in the 23rd minute,” according to MHS head coach Joseph Elger in an email.
“MCS scored another goal then pulled away late, with three goals in the last 15 minutes,” Elger added.
